Biden admits it was an error to omit his name from COVID checks


President Joe Biden praised former President Donald Trump for signing COVID stimulus checks while warning against a return to “trickle-down economics” in a legacy-focused speech. Biden highlighted the American Rescue Plan as the most significant economic recovery package and emphasized the importance of stimulus checks in aiding the nation’s economic recovery. However, Biden acknowledged that Trump received stronger approval marks on the economy during his presidency.

Biden criticized Trump’s tax and tariff policies, cautioning against tax cuts for the wealthy and across-the-board tariffs that would increase costs for American consumers. Biden expressed concern over Project 2025, a policy blueprint for tax cuts for the wealthy, and warned of its potential economic impact. Biden also highlighted his economic achievements, including job growth, low unemployment rates, increased GDP, and reduced inflation.

Biden urged Republican lawmakers to support his infrastructure, microchip, and climate initiatives, emphasizing the economic benefits these projects would bring to their states or districts. He criticized those opposed to his legislation but later celebrated the economic improvements resulting from it. Ultimately, Biden encouraged lawmakers to prioritize economic growth and development for the benefit of all Americans.
